Common use of Becoming a Candidate to University Professor Clause in Contracts

Becoming a Candidate to University Professor. The individual faculty member may become a candidate for University Professor by being nominated by any ranked faculty or by self-nomination. The candidate will be responsible for the preparation of the dossier. The dossier shall be confined to activities within the time frame of current rank and should not exceed twenty (20) pages.
